## Authentication

Before you can run `shrinkwrangler batch` against the Pellmere asset store, the CLI needs to know who you are. It reads credentials from your local config, so no flags to memorize. Fun fact: the resizer farm rejects anonymous jobs outright, so skipping this step means cryptic timeout errors. For local dev, everyone on the team uses the shared staging key shown here.

app token of yagaf-bahop = vxb2-4d

### Cron drift — notes (Tuesview sync)

Scheduled jobs on the Pellwick cluster drifted ~40s/day. Root cause suspected: NTP peer misconfig on node pool B, not the scheduler itself. Action: contractor to reproduce drift in staging, capture offsets hourly for 48h. Don't touch prod crontabs yet. Escalation path and final sign-off run through the owner listed below.

account owner for kafop-haweg: Pelax Gilael Istir

**Checklist item 14 — TideGlass widget verification.** Before publishing, confirm that the TideGlass tide-table widget renders correctly for both semidiurnal and mixed tide datasets supplied by the Marrowport sample feed. Plugin authors must verify that the offset slider honors the host app's unit preference and that empty harbor entries degrade gracefully to a dashed placeholder row. Once all three sample harbors pass visual review, record the verification by appending the build token below.

session token of tajog-fahaf = htk21_4ae55819f45410afcb307

Subject: Profile store sharding — cut-over complete

Team,

The Harrowlane user-profile store is now sharded. Four shards, keyed by user ID hash. Cut-over finished at 02:40 with ~3 minutes of read-only mode. No data loss. Support impact: profile lookups may show up to 60s of stale data while caches settle. Old single-node store stays read-only for a week as fallback. Escalate anything weird to the Shardling channel. The live shard configuration is as follows:

settings of tagef-bawif:
DRUIX_HOST=druix.zemvarlabs.internal
DRUIX_PORT=8000